Budget Analyst II

The State Bureau of Investigation (SBI) is dedicated to increasing public safety in North Carolina through various investigative services. The Budget Analyst II will manage and implement appropriations and federal funds, conduct budget analysis, and ensure compliance with budget execution deadlines.

Responsibilities

Conducts advanced budget analysis work for various funding streams
Prepares, documents, and submits budget realignment requests
Addresses and resolves any budget discrepancies
Assists with the monthly, quarterly, and yearly closeout processes
Supports budget certification and expansion budget processes
Prepares quarterly allotments and cash projections
Payroll Time and Salary Control Specialist for the department
Provides employee benefits management for the department

Required

Bachelor's degree in business administration, public administration, accounting, or related field, from an accredited institution and four years of experience preferably including experience in accounting or budgeting
Equivalent combination of education and experience
All work history and education (including accurate dates of employment/attendance) must be documented on the application
Transcripts may be attached to supplement education and work experience may include internships, volunteerism, and full and part-time work
Supplemental Questions are also a required part of the application: answers must reference education or work experience listed on the application
Selected candidates will undergo and must successfully complete a comprehensive background investigation which includes: credit and arrest checks; interviews with associates, personal and business references; verification interviews of employers; verification of education achievement; urinalysis drug screening; and submission of fingerprints
Degrees must be received from appropriately accredited institutions
If applicants earned college credit hours but did not complete a degree program, they must attach an unofficial transcript to each application to receive credit for this education
If you earned a foreign degree, you must attach your official evaluation for U.S. equivalency to your application to receive credit for your degree as foreign degrees require an official evaluation for U.S. equivalency
